Choosing a university major is a pivotal moment in your life. It's a stepping stone that can shape your future career path and overall direction. Despite this, it's also a daunting task, as there are so many diverse fields to explore.

The key is to intentionally consider your interests, skills, and aspirations. Consider what truly passionates you. What subjects do you enjoy learning about? What kind of work environment would suit your personality?

Once you have a deeper understanding of yourself, you can start to explore different majors that align with your strengths. Converse with professors, advisors, and professionals in fields that intrigue you.

Attend university events to learn more about specific programs and cultures. Remember, choosing a major is not a final decision. Many students change their majors over time as they explore new passions and perspectives.

University Majors Demystified

Selecting a university major is a pivotal decision that influences your academic journey and future career prospects. Despite this, the vast array of majors available can be confusing. To make an informed choice, it's essential to conduct thorough research.

Begin by exploring your passions and interests. What subjects do you find intellectually stimulating? Consider what kind of work environment motivates you.

Develop a list of potential majors that correspond to your interests. Research each major thoroughly, including its coursework, career opportunities, and required skills.

Talk to faculty members in fields that spark your curiosity.

Their experiences can provide valuable direction. Remember, your major is not unchangeable. Many students switch paths throughout their college careers. Be open to reconsidering your path as you grow.

Ultimately, the best university major for you is the one that ignites your enthusiasm and equips you for a fulfilling future.

Navigating the Transition from Student to Professional

Embarking on your professional journey after graduation can feel both exhilarating and daunting. By utilizing strategic planning and effective strategies, you can seamlessly transition from campus to career.

  • Begin by crafting a compelling resume that highlights your skills and experiences relevant to your desired field.
  • Subsequently, network actively with professionals in your industry to build valuable connections and gain insightful advice.
  • Prepare for job interviews by researching companies, anticipating common questions, and showcasing your enthusiasm for the role.
Remember that your career path is a journey, not a destination. Be open to various opportunities and continuously develop your skills to stay competitive in the evolving job market.
